Local magnetic behavior of 54Fe in EuFe2As2: microscopic study by perturbed angular distribution spectroscopy

Description

We report time differential perturbed angular distribution measurement of 54Fe on a polycrystalline EuFe2As2 sample. The local susceptibility measured shows Curie-Weiss like temperature dependence in the paramagnetic region. The spin-lattice relaxation observed shows Korringa like relaxation and changes discontinuously at TS = T N= 190 K. Below TN, the hyperfine field shows two components. The low filed component of the hyperfine field shows a power law dependence of 0.27 on temperature. (author)
